Biography
Jalena Jampolsky is a Ph.D. student focusing on
the history of photography and nineteenth- and early twentieth-century American
art and decorative arts at the University of Delaware. From 2017-2019, she was
the Henry Luce Foundation Research Associate of American Art at the Newark
Museum. Jampolsky was also the Tiffany and Co. Foundation Curatorial Intern in
American Decorative Arts at the Metropolitan Museum of Art (2016-2017). At the
Met, her research focused on the use of photography in American decorative
arts, specifically Tiffany Studios. She received her M.A. in the History of Art
and Archeology from New York University's Institute of Fine Arts; and received
her B.A. with honors in the History of Art and Visual Culture from the
University of California, Santa Cruz.
